Cover Letter 1

Subject: Experienced Massage Therapist Seeking Position at Serenity Spa

Dear Hiring Manager,

I am excited to apply for the position of Massage Therapist at Serenity Spa. With over five years of experience providing therapeutic massage services, I am confident in my ability to contribute to your team and deliver exceptional care to your clients.

Throughout my career, I have honed my skills in Swedish, deep tissue, and hot stone massage techniques. I pride myself on my ability to listen attentively to clients’ needs and customize each session to address their specific concerns. My commitment to continuing education has allowed me to stay current with the latest trends and techniques in the field.

In addition to my technical skills, I am known for my warm, empathetic demeanor and ability to put clients at ease. I understand the importance of creating a relaxing and welcoming environment, and I consistently receive positive feedback from clients for my professionalism and ability to provide a truly rejuvenating experience.

I am excited about the opportunity to bring my skills and passion to Serenity Spa. I believe my experience and dedication to client satisfaction make me an excellent fit for your team.

Thank you for considering my application. I look forward to the opportunity to discuss how I can contribute to the success of Serenity Spa.

[Your Name]

What should a Massage Therapist cover letter include?

A massage therapist cover letter should include a few key components to ensure the best chance at making a good impression on potential employers. The letter should begin with a brief introduction of the candidate and their qualifications, followed by an explanation of why they’re interested in the specific massage therapist position.

Next, the letter should include a few statements that demonstrate the candidate’s strong knowledge of the massage therapy profession, as well as their commitment to providing quality services to their clients. This could include any certifications, memberships, or special training they possess.

The body of the letter should then focus on explaining why the candidate is a good fit for the particular position. The candidate should be sure to mention any relevant experience in the field of massage therapy, as well as any special skills they may have.

Lastly, the cover letter should include a closing paragraph. This should include a statement of appreciation for the recipient’s time and consideration, as well as a request for an interview if the candidate is selected. The letter should also include contact information, such as the candidate’s email address or phone number.

Common mistakes to avoid when writing Massage Therapist Cover letter

Writing a cover letter is an important part of the job search process, but it can be intimidating. Massage therapists must adhere to strict guidelines and have a lot of competition when applying for jobs. Knowing what to avoid when crafting your cover letter can make all the difference. Here are some common mistakes to avoid when writing a massage therapist cover letter:

  • Not Customizing for the Position: Every massage therapist cover letter should be tailored to the position you are applying for. Take the time to read the job listing carefully and research the company. Doing this will help you demonstrate why you are the perfect fit for the job.
  • Going Over the Word Limit: Cover letters should never be too long. Aim to keep your letter to one page, and focus on only the qualifications that are most relevant to the job.
  • Not Proofreading: Proofreading is absolutely essential when writing any type of document, especially a cover letter. It is important to make sure there are no mistakes or typos that could be off- putting to potential employers.
  • Omitting Contact Information: Don’t forget to include your contact information at the top of the letter. This should include your name, address, phone number and email address.
  • Not Including a Professional Greeting: Make sure to start your cover letter with a professional greeting. Address the letter to the hiring manager or person who posted the job listing.
  • Not Highlighting Your Qualifications: Your cover letter should be an opportunity to highlight your qualifications and experience. Take the time to go over your resume and include any relevant information that you think will convince the employer to hire you.
  • Not Closing Appropriately: Make sure to end your cover letter with a professional closing. Thank the employer for their time and request an interview. This will help to create a lasting impression.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in a Massage Therapist Cover Letter

When applying for a position as a massage therapist, your cover letter serves as a vital introduction to your professional skills and personality. It's your opportunity to showcase your passion for wellness, your understanding of client needs, and your ability to create a soothing environment. However, many applicants make common mistakes that can undermine their chances of making a positive impression. To ensure your cover letter stands out for the right reasons, here are some pitfalls to avoid:

  • Generic Greeting : Using a vague salutation like "To Whom It May Concern" instead of addressing the hiring manager by name can make your letter feel impersonal.
  • Lack of Personalization : Failing to tailor your cover letter to the specific job or clinic can signal a lack of genuine interest in the position.
  • Ignoring Job Requirements : Not mentioning specific qualifications or experiences that align with the job description can weaken your application.
  • Overly Lengthy Paragraphs : Long paragraphs can be overwhelming; instead, use concise sentences and bullet points to enhance readability.
  • Neglecting Soft Skills : As a massage therapist, interpersonal skills are crucial. Omitting these qualities can make your application less appealing.
  • Being Too Formal or Informal : Striking the right tone is essential; being overly casual or too stiff can alienate potential employers.
  • Focusing Solely on Technical Skills : While techniques are important, neglecting to emphasize your approach to client care misses an opportunity to showcase your holistic practice.
  • Spelling and Grammar Errors : Typos can detract from your professionalism and attention to detail, which are critical in the massage therapy field.
  • Not Including a Call to Action : Failing to express your desire for an interview or further discussion can leave your application feeling incomplete.
  • Using Clichés or Jargon : Overused phrases or technical jargon can make your letter sound generic and less engaging. Instead, aim for authenticity and clarity.
